@charset "utf-8";
/* CSS Document */

body
{
	background: #780008;
	color: #EEEEEE;
	font-family: Georgia;
	margin-top: 6px;
	margin-bottom: 6px;
	margin-left: 0px;
	margin-right: 0px;
}

.base
{
	position: relative;
	width: 844px;
	margin: auto;
}

.top
{
	position: static;
	width: 844px;
	height: 13px;
	background: url(../big/topbord.png) no-repeat center top;
}

.underbottom
{
	position: static;
	width: 844px;
	background: url(../big/mainback.png) repeat-y center top;
	margin: auto;
}

.overbottom
{
	position: static;
	width: 844px;
	height: auto;
	background: url(../big/downback.png) no-repeat center bottom;
	margin: auto;
	z-index: 10;
	padding-bottom: 10px;
}

.logo
{
	position: static;
	width: 844px;
	height: 198px;
	background: url(../big/top.png) no-repeat center center;
}

.menu
{
	position: static;
	width: 844px;
	height: 106px;
	background: url(../big/menu.png) no-repeat center center;
}

#inicia{
	width: 106px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 56px;
	top: 217px;
}
	#iniciaspacer{
	position: absolute;
	width: 89px;
	top: 7px;
	left: 8px;
	height: 31px;
	z-index: 0;
	}
	
	#inicia:hover{
		background: url(../big/buttons/inicio.png) no-repeat;
		z-index: 100;
	}

#reglas{
	width: 106px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 161px;
	top: 217px;
}
	#reglasspacer{
	position: absolute;
	width: 89px;
	top: 7px;
	left: 9px;
	height: 31px;
	z-index: 0;
	}
	
	#reglas:hover{
		background: url(../big/buttons/reglas.png) no-repeat;
		z-index: 100;
	}
	
#requisitos{
	width: 136px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 267px;
	top: 217px;
}
	#requisitosspacer{
	position: absolute;
	width: 118px;
	top: 7px;
	left: 8px;
	height: 31px;
	z-index: 0;
	}
	
	#requisitos:hover{
		background: url(../big/buttons/requisitos.png) no-repeat;
		z-index: 100;
	}
	
#condiciones{
	width: 148px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 401px;
	top: 217px;
}
	#condicionesspacer{
	position: absolute;
	width: 133px;
	top: 7px;
	left: 10px;
	height: 31px;
	z-index: 0;
	}
	
	#condiciones:hover{
		background: url(../big/buttons/condiciones.png) no-repeat;
		z-index: 100;
	}
	
#programa{
	width: 239px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 551px;
	top: 217px;
}
	#programaspacer{
	position: absolute;
	width: 219px;
	top: 7px;
	left: 9px;
	height: 31px;
	z-index: 0;
	}
	
	#programa:hover{
		background: url(../big/buttons/programa.png) no-repeat;
		z-index: 100;
	}

#premios{
	width: 124px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 125px;
	top: 262px;
}
	#premiosspacer{
	position: absolute;
	width: 106px;
	top: 8px;
	left: 8px;
	height: 31px;
	z-index: 0;
	}
	
	#premios:hover{
		background: url(../big/buttons/premios.png) no-repeat;
		z-index: 100;
	}

#patrocinadores{
	width: 236px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 247px;
	top: 262px;
}
	#patrocinadoresspacer{
	position: absolute;
	width: 219px;
	top: 8px;
	left: 8px;
	height: 31px;
	z-index: 0;
	}
	
	#patrocinadores:hover{
		background: url(../big/buttons/patrocinadores.png) no-repeat;
		z-index: 100;
	}

#galeria{
	width: 124px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 482px;
	top: 262px;
}
	#galeriaspacer{
	position: absolute;
	width: 106px;
	top: 8px;
	left: 8px;
	height: 31px;
	z-index: 0;
	}
	
	#galeria:hover{
		background: url(../big/buttons/galeria.png) no-repeat;
		z-index: 100;
	}

#contacto{
	width: 119px;
	height: 46px;
	position: absolute;
	z-index: 0;
	left: 602px;
	top: 262px;
}
	#contactospacer{
	position: absolute;
	width: 102px;
	top: 8px;
	left: 9px;
	height: 31px;
	z-index: 0;
	}
	
	#contacto:hover{
		background: url(../big/buttons/contacto.png) no-repeat;
		z-index: 100;
	}

#textfield
{
	width: 800px;
	position: static;
	margin: auto;
	margin-top: 0px;
	margin-bottom: 250px;
	z-index: 19;
}

.texttop
{
	position: static;
	width: 800px;
	height: 9px;
	/*background: url(../big/texttopback.png) no-repeat center center;*/
	margin-top: 10px;
	z-index: 20;
}

.textmiddle
{
	position: static;
	width: 800px;
	height: auto;
	/*background: url(../big/textmiddleback.png) repeat-y center top;*/
	z-index: 20;
}

.textbottom
{
	position: static;
	width: 800px;
	height: 9px;
	/*background: url(../big/textbottomback.png) no-repeat center center;*/
	z-index: 20;
}

.internaltext
{
	position: relative;
	width: 720px;
	padding: 20px;
	margin: auto;
}

h3
{
	color: #f9c602;
	font-family: Georgia;
}

.h3
{
	color: #f9c602;
	font-family: Georgia;
}

a img
{
	border: none;
}

.programa#jovenes {
	position: absolute;
	top: 50px;
	left: 0px;
	width: 319px;
	text-align: left;
	border: none;
	height: 300px;
	}

.programa#mayores {
	position: absolute;
	top: 50px;
	left: 371px;
	width: 318px;
	text-align: left;
	border: none;
	height: 416px;
	}

a:link, a:visited, a:active
{
	color: #F9C602;
}

a:hover
{
	color: #FFFF00;
}

.nolmin
{
	position: absolute;
	width: 47px;
	height: 20px;
	background: url(../big/nm.png) no-repeat center center;
	left: 763px;
	top: 1212px;
}

.anuncio
{
	position: static;
	width: 700px;
	margin: auto;
}

.anuncio #top
{
	background: url(../images/wtop.png) no-repeat center top;
	height: 13px;
}

.anuncio #mid
{
	background: url(../images/wmid.png) repeat-y center top;
}

.anuncio #bot
{
	background: url(../images/wbot.png) no-repeat center top;
	height: 13px;
}

.anuncio 
{
	color: #000000;
	font-family: Georgia;
	font-size: 12px;
	font-weight: bold;
	text-decoration: none;
}

.anuncio #text
{
	width: 95%;
	line-height: 24px;
}

.copyright
{
	font-size: 12px;
	color: #f9c602;
}
